The Decadent Delight: Dark Chocolate’s Rich History and Health Benefits

Dark chocolate, a decadent treat beloved by many, has a rich history dating back thousands of years. Originating from the cacao bean, dark chocolate was first consumed by ancient civilizations in Mesoamerica. The Mayans and Aztecs revered cacao as a sacred ingredient used in ceremonial drinks. “Reel in the Benefits: The Rise of Pescatarianism for a Healthier Lifestyle”

Pescatarianism is a dietary pattern that includes fish and seafood but excludes meat and poultry. This way of eating has gained popularity in recent years due to its numerous health benefits.
